Projector of slides

A projector of slides is a instrument optical making it possible to view Diapositive S by projection of the image on a white surface of big size (that it is a wall or a adapted screen). Description and operation

A projector of slides includes/understands four principal elements:
  1. a source of Light cooled by a Ventilator, which preferably cools also the slide
  2. reflectors and a condenser to uniformly direct the light towards the slide
  3. a housing for the slide, even a Pass-sight, simple or with basket
  4. an objective

Certain models are equipped with a system Autofocus making it possible as well as possible to focus the image on the screen.

The principal manufacturers of projectors of slides are Agfa, Kindermann, Kodak, Leica, Prestinox, Rollei and Simda.

These Projecteur S tends today to being replaced by Vidéoprojecteur numerical S, or projectors, producing a less clear image and still much more expensive than of the projectors of slides. On the other hand the digital image presents much more facilities than the slide to carry out a Diaporama, especially in dissolve-connected.

Types of projectors

  • projector with right basket
  • projector with round basket (for example Carousel)
  • projector stereo (simultaneously projects two slides with different polarizations; the sights then appear in relief with special glasses)
